Cape Town is South Africa’s oldest city, its second-most populous and an important contributor to national employment. It is the legislative capital of South Africa, the administrative and economic centre of the Western Cape, and Africa’s third-biggest economic hub.The City of Cape Town aims to ensure fast, effective service and communication with our pu...

Key Performance Areas
Identifying, defining and undertaking immediate, short- and long-term planning associated with broadly defined bulk water infrastructure projects, the New Water Programme and other infrastructure projects.
Providing inputs to the utilisation, productivity and performance of personnel within the Infrastructure and Project Implementation Section of Bulk Water.
Preparing Capital and Operating estimates within a planned project and managing and controlling expenditure against approved budget allocations.
Managing multi-disciplinary teams for broadly defined projects including investigations, design, project management, contract administration, construction supervision, commissioning and hand- over of major/minor future infrastructure, upgrades of present infrastructure and operational driven technical projects.
Providing engineering guidance, maintaining technical standards and infrastructure and the protection of rights for broadly defined projects.
Relationship management and communication.
Administration and the safekeeping of written communication.
